Come to the Yorkshire Riding Centre for a 1/2 day camp themed around British Dressage Competitions. With a focus on gaining experience riding BD tests and how to preparae for a competition.
The day will comprise of 2 ridden sessions including:
Working In Wobbles - Do you find it challenging to work with groups of riders? This will be a flat work session working with other combinations under the guidance of one of our coaches.
Dressage Test Practice - You will have the opportunity to ride through a British Dressage test of your choice. This will be judged, feedback given, score sheet and rosette.
Sessions are tailored to suit the combinations. This camp is very tailored and designed to be exactly what you and your confidence needs!
There will be a “Let’s Get Going” rider fitness session plus other practical sessions.
